What is a corporate finance graduate?

A Corporate Finance Graduate is an entry-level professional, usually with a recent degree in finance, accounting, or a related field, who joins a corporate finance team within a company or financial institution. These graduates typically participate in structured training programs that expose them to key areas like financial analysis, budgeting, forecasting, mergers and acquisitions, and capital management. The role is designed to build foundational skills, provide practical experience, and prepare graduates for more specialized or senior finance roles. Corporate Finance Graduates often work with senior analysts and managers, contributing to financial planning and decision-making processes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a corporate finance graduate?

To thrive as a Corporate Finance Graduate, you need solid analytical abilities, a strong grasp of financial principles, and typically a degree in finance, accounting, or a related field. Familiarity with financial modeling software, Excel, and en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ems is common, and relevant internships or certifications like CFA Level 1 can be advantageous. Attention to detail, effective communication, and teamwork are essential soft skills for excelling in cross-functional projects and presenting financial insights.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ering accurate financial analysis and supporting strategic business decisions in a dynamic corporate environment.

What projects or tasks can a corporate finance graduate expect to work on during their first year?

As a Corporate Finance Graduate, you can expect to be involved in a range of projects such as financial analysis, budgeting, forecasting, and preparing reports for management. You may assist with mergers and acquisitions, conduct market research, or help with due diligence processes. Collaboration is common, as you'll often work closely with senior analysts, accountants, and other departments to gather data and deliver insights. This exposure helps you build a strong foundation in financial principles and develop important analytical and communication skills early in your career.

About the Role
FTI Consulting is seeking a Director to join our growing Transactions Financial Due Diligence team. Our Financial Due Diligence team is aligned with FTI Consulting's Corporate Finance organization.
In FTI Consulting's Corporate Finance organization, we focus on our clients' strategic, operational, financial and capital needs by addressing the full spectrum of financial and transactional opportunities faced by corporations, boards, private equity sponsors, creditor constituencies and other stakeholders.
The Transactions Financial Due Diligence team offers competitive advice and support by evaluating the risk/return considerations in all stages of the deal continuum.
Areas of focus include: Quality of Earnings (EBITDA), Working Capital, Quality of Net Assets, Forecast, Debt and Debt Like Items, Customer/Product/Channel/Category sales and margins, inventory costing and bill of materials.
